Job Responsibilities
- Operate manufacturing equipment following standard operating procedures (SOPs) and work instructions.
- Perform machine start-up, operation, and changeovers.
- Monitor equipment performance and complete routine process checks.
- Record production data and maintain accurate operational logs.
- Complete work orders and manufacturing documentation accurately.
- Assist with preventive maintenance activities as directed.
- Move materials using a pallet jack and maintain material traceability.
- Maintain clean, organized, and safe work areas.
- Inspect raw materials and finished products to ensure quality standards are met.
- Follow GMP, safety regulations, and company policies at all times.
- Report equipment issues or production concerns to supervisors promptly.
- Support inventory accuracy and maintain complete production records.
